Analysis
OpenAI's approach to sourcing training data from contractors introduces significant data security and privacy risks, particularly concerning the thoroughness of anonymization. The reliance on contractors to strip out sensitive information places a considerable burden and potential liability on them. This could result in unintended data leaks and compromise the integrity of OpenAI's AI agent training dataset.
